Output 3817fe30289d17d2fa7c8f0cea36bd062db72716b6eaf19c798bc93443bfea71:8

value
3316655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b1ec3de58762d37e59a059b1a3e22eac75467c0 OP_EQUAL
address
3ENchogJGHPVqYwNm5ohVtru5BytuxUoU7
transaction
3817fe30289d17d2fa7c8f0cea36bd062db72716b6eaf19c798bc93443bfea71
spent
true